Wild coincidence but for teams who have championship aspirations who are in tank mode, they shouldn't want the #1 pick. It's the kiss of death.


It's kinda wild how that #1 selections almost never win a title for the team that drafts them.
It’s not that wild when you figure the team was a #1 seed in the first place and for a reason. And then if you have a more transcendent first pick (Shaq, Bron, etc) they’re immediately going to make you too good to get another top pick (yes I know the Magic for the number one pick immediately after drafting Shaq but record wise them winning the lottery wasn’t expected).
